    rammy007 wrote: »
    Is there a pattern for these theyre fab!

    Sorry for the late reply! And for those who pm'd me here is the pattern i used -http://www.scribd.com/doc/18733650/Easter-Chicks
    but for the beak i used this pattern - CO 7 st, knit 5 rows, k2t , knit3, k2t (you have 5st left), knit 2 rows, k2t, knit 1, k2t (you have 3sts left), knit 2 rows, k2t, knit 1 (you have 2 sts left), k2t to bind off.
